Description


This course is the second of two parts and is undertaken after the satisfactory completion of CVEN4030 Honours Thesis A. Successful completion of Parts A and B are required to obtain an honours degree. The honours thesis may describe directed research work on an approved subject and will be completed under the guidance and supervision of a member of the academic staff. The research may involve a directed laboratory or field investigation, analytical or numerical modelling, a detailed design, literature review or such other individual research project approved by the Head of School. Part B involves independently completing the research project and writing a thesis fully describing the problem, the nature of the work undertaken, the aims and objectives, the research methodology, the research outcomes, results and conclusions.
